Henry Elmus Holcombe 1879–1960 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 27 March 1879

Birth Location: Honey Grove, Fannin County, Texas

Death Date: 13 Jun 1960

Death Location: Fort Worth, Tarrant County, Texas, USA

Father: Samuel Holcombe

Mother: Cynthia Haynes

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

The story of Henry Elmus Holcombe began in 1879 in Honey Grove, Fannin County, Texas. In 1900, Henry Elmus Holcombe resided in Roxton, Lamar, Texas, USA. Henry Elmus Holcombe passed away in 1960 in Fort Worth, Tarrant County, Texas, USA.
